Straightforward and content-rich, this is your go-to resource for learning the Bible—verse by verse, chapter by chapter, and book by book. Hosted by Bayside Pastor Curt Harlow and our resident apologetics savant, Dena Davidson. You’ll grow in your understanding of both exegesis (how we arrive at the original meaning of the text) and hermeneutics (the tools, context, and questions we use for interpreting the text). When Paul preached in Ephesus, it didn’t just change hearts—it disrupted an entire economy. In Acts 19, a silversmith named Demetrius sparks a riot against Paul, fearing the gospel will ruin his business and offend their city’s god, Artemis.
